I have a JL 12w3v2 with an older Rockford Fosgate amp. The amp is mounted on the backside of the rear seats and the sub is in a 1x1x1 enclosure. I've always preferred sealed vs ported as it hits tighter.

Overall it doesn't take up much space. I just shove it to the back. In order to make it work the installer had to use a line out converter for the RCA input and usual power, ground, remote turn on etc. Should cost more than $25-30 for a converter

You'll need some sort of oem integration processor to connect to the outputs of the factory amp to sum up a usable signal to connect to a new amp if you want to replace your front speaker or your mids and highs. If you're just adding a subwoofer and an amp to power it, it is pretty simple.
